PIC是由Microchip Technology制造的哈佛架构微控制器系列。
我想用我的PIC18F4550,蓝牙模块HC-06和计算机进行简单测试。我的意思是,我想使用蓝牙模块从PIC向PC发送一个简单字符。应该是...
无法使用PIC18F4620初始化Qapass 1602A LCD
我无法使用PIC18F4620初始化QAPASS 1602A LCD,我总是在两条线上都得到正方形块。一开始,我以为LCD坏了,所以我换了一块新的,但结果是一样的。我用...
我编写了一个使用Timer0中断的程序。我在第11行出现错误,它是12.14声明中没有标识符这是完整的代码:#include #define _XTAL_FREQ 4000000#...
我对使用PIC芯片还比较陌生,因此这可能是一个新手级别的问题,但是我试图编写一个头文件,其中包括所有其他文件的TRIS / ODC / INIT掩码...
我正在尝试编写一个对计时器0使用中断的程序。问题是我必须添加一个具有2个变量的函数。通过使用...
我正在尝试实现一种从dsPIC33F将数据写入SD卡的方法。我目前可以通过UART将数据传输到蓝牙和USB,但是关于写入...
我正在与Microchip的PIC 18F微控制器一起工作,以连续生成矩形信号。信号本身的代码位于label5。我需要生成255 * 20个该信号的脉冲。 ...
我正在与Microchip的PIC 18F微控制器一起工作,以连续生成矩形信号。信号本身的代码位于label5。我需要生成255 * 20个该信号的脉冲。 ...
作为基于此问题的新问题发布(OP最初对已回退的问题进行了重大更改),因为用户表示无法自己提出问题。关于PIC 16F877A:I ...
关于PIC 16F877A:我从UART(COM端口)接收并显示到LCD 16x4。我收到的数据形成了:Line1#Line2#Line3#Line4我想将接收到的数据如下所示:/ * LCD16x4:~~~~~~ ...
如何在CCS中使用字符串?我可以使用:string myString =“ My String”; //错误或否?
如何在CCS中使用字符串?我试过了:#include 但是我仍然有错误:string myString =“ My String”; //错误
我正在用C的PIC微处理器进行工作。它是16F,所以它不能容纳大于32位的整数(无符号int32是可用的最大数据大小)从阅读器中,我收到5字节的ID代码。到...
如何通过I2C在Raspberry pi和PIC器件(PIC16F18325)之间进行通信
我正在尝试通过I2C与PIC设备的Raspberry pi 3B +通信。我的PIC器件是PIC16F18325。首先,我通过使用MCC(mplab代码配置)生成了i2c库。树莓派已设置...
我有一个练习考试问题,要求我将PORTB输入逻辑电平读入一个称为result的单个char变量中。 (在PIC18F252上)。我对此有一些想法,但我没有答案可以检查...
[使用HiTech Pic18 C编译器使用C代码复位PIC18的最佳方法是什么?编辑:我正在使用void reset(){#asm reset #endasm},但是必须有更好的方法
我对PIC汇编器中的存储区切换感到困惑...这适用于在USART上放置'Q':bsf PORTB,1;设置发送DIR(其他存储区中未镜像的PORTB(0x6))movlw'Q '...
[使用addwf pic18f2x向PCL添加值时的PCH重置
我试图通过在程序计数器中添加某个索引来在汇编中使用简单的查找表。它似乎在PCL范围内工作(直到0xff),但此后,当PCH出现时...
我有一个奇怪的问题。最好在附图中进行说明。我使用的是将MPLAB和XC8写入C的PIC16F18323。PIC的程序存储器只有2KB,所以我...